Understanding the consent agenda form

A consent agenda is a meeting tool that consolidates multiple routine or non-controversial items into a single section of the agenda. This approach allows boards, committees, or teams to handle approval of those items collectively rather than discussing each one individually.

The primary purpose of a consent agenda is to enhance meeting efficiency. The form streamlines discussions by enabling members to approve several items with a single motion, freeing up time for more pressing issues that require in-depth deliberation.

Common misconceptions surrounding consent agendas often stem from misunderstanding their function and purpose. Some believe they are merely a way to bypass important discussions, while in reality, they are intended to promote efficiency and focus on vital issues.

How the consent agenda works

Implementing a consent agenda requires a structured process, which aids in ensuring its effectiveness. Preparation before the meeting is crucial. This involves identifying routine items that can be placed on the consent agenda, gathering necessary documentation, and distributing them to members ahead of time.

During the meeting, the chair typically presents the consent agenda for review. Members have the opportunity to ask questions or request to pull items out of the consent agenda for further discussion if needed. Usually, approval requires a simple motion followed by a vote.

After the meeting, accountability is key. The organization should ensure that any items withdrawn for discussion are addressed promptly, and this is where follow-up actions play a critical role.

Components of an effective consent agenda form

Creating an effective consent agenda form involves careful consideration of which items should be included. Routine approvals, such as meeting minutes and financial reports, are essential components of the consent agenda. Recommendations from committees and other regular reporting items also belong here.

Beyond mandatory items, optional items can also be considered. The layout should prioritize clarity and usability—using clear headings, bullet points for easy scanning, and sufficient space for notes can enhance comprehension and usability.

Best practices for creating consent agendas

When preparing a consent agenda, adherence to formatting principles can significantly improve clarity. Utilizing a consistent template, ensuring all items are succinctly described, and including any necessary documents or context allows members to grasp the purpose of each item quickly.

Effective communication about the agenda items is paramount. Being explicit about the intent and action required for each item prepares members for discussions and decision-making.

Common missteps and how to avoid them

A frequent pitfall in utilizing consent agendas is including items that foster debate or require significant deliberation. Disputes should be handled outside the consent framework—ensuring that items included are routine and non-controversial is essential to maintain the agenda's integrity.

Furthermore, misuse of consent agendas can lead to disengagement amongst members. Real-world case studies demonstrate that a lack of member involvement or failure to discuss pulled items can result in frustration. Encouraging full participation protects against these challenges.

Frequently asked questions about consent agendas

One common question regarding consent agendas is what occurs if a member disagrees with an item listed. Typically, individual members can request to pull an item from the consent agenda for further discussion before the vote takes place.

Another frequent inquiry involves whether a motion is necessary to approve the consent agenda. Yes, a single motion is required, but members may discuss items if they wish to voice concerns or seek clarifications.

A consent agenda is a collection of items on a meeting agenda that are grouped together and approved in one motion, allowing for efficient handling of routine matters without discussion.
Typically, the governing body of an organization, such as a board of directors or committee members, is required to file a consent agenda to streamline the decision-making process.
To fill out a consent agenda, list the items to be approved, include a brief description of each item, and ensure all necessary supporting documents are attached for review prior to the meeting.
The purpose of a consent agenda is to save time during meetings by allowing the group to approve routine matters collectively, thus enabling more time for discussion of substantive issues.
The consent agenda must report items such as minutes from previous meetings, routine financial reports, and other non-controversial items requiring approval.
